STATE FARM MUTUAL AUTOMOBILE INSURANCE COMPANY v. JOHN DEERE INSURANCE COMPANY


288 A.D.2d 294 (2001)

733 N.Y.S.2d 198

STATE FARM MUTUAL AUTOMOBILE INSURANCE COMPANY, Respondent, v. JOHN DEERE INSURANCE COMPANY et al., Appellants.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

Decided November 13, 2001.


Ordered that the order and judgment is reversed, on the law, with costs, the defendants' motion for summary judgment is granted, and it is declared that John Deere Insurance Company is not required to defend or indemnify Gloria Kandel in the underlying action.
